Hiring a CodeIgniter developer can significantly enhance your web development projects, ensuring you leverage the full potential of this powerful PHP framework. Whether you need scalable, secure web applications or custom web solutions tailored to your business needs, dedicated CodeIgniter developers bring specialized skills and expertise to the table. This article will guide you through the benefits, hiring process, cost considerations, and best practices for managing CodeIgniter developers.

Hire Codeigniter Developer: Key Takeaways

  • Hiring a skilled CodeIgniter developer can lead to the creation of scalable and secure web applications tailored to your business needs.
  • There are various platforms and methods to find and recruit dedicated CodeIgniter developers, including online job boards, local recruitment, and networking events.
  • Evaluating a CodeIgniter developer involves assessing their essential skills, experience, and portfolio, as well as asking the right interview questions.
  • The cost of hiring a CodeIgniter developer can vary based on factors such as expertise, location, and hiring model, with options ranging from freelancers to full-time employees.
  • Effective management and onboarding of CodeIgniter developers involve setting up a conducive development environment, clear communication strategies, and regular performance monitoring.

Why Hire a CodeIgniter Developer?

CodeIgniter developer coding on a laptop.

Hiring dedicated CodeIgniter developers ensures that you have access to experts with specialized skills in CodeIgniter development, leading to optimal performance and high-quality results. Dedicated CodeIgniter developers are well-versed in the latest CodeIgniter frameworks, tools, and technologies, and can create cutting-edge web applications that cater to the unique needs of your business.

CodeIgniter, a PHP framework equipped with versatile toolkits, simplifies development. Our CodeIgniter developers specialize in crafting scalable and secure web solutions tailored to diverse industries. Understanding unique business goals, our dedicated team delivers feature-rich web solutions. Hire CodeIgniter developers on-demand to address evolving needs and build scalable solutions aligned with your business requirements.

CodeIgniter offers numerous benefits, making it a preferred choice for web development. It is known for its simplicity, speed, and performance. The framework’s lightweight nature ensures that applications run efficiently, providing a seamless user experience. Additionally, CodeIgniter’s extensive documentation and active community support make it easier for developers to troubleshoot issues and implement new features.

The CodeIgniter framework boasts several key features that enhance the development process. These include a small footprint, exceptional performance, and a straightforward configuration. The framework also supports MVC architecture, which promotes organized and maintainable code. Furthermore, CodeIgniter offers robust security features, including built-in protection against CSRF and XSS attacks, ensuring that your applications remain secure.

Many businesses have achieved significant success by leveraging the CodeIgniter framework. From e-commerce platforms to enterprise applications, CodeIgniter has proven its versatility and reliability. Companies have reported improved performance, faster development cycles, and reduced costs by choosing to hire CodeIgniter developers. These success stories highlight the framework’s ability to deliver high-quality, scalable solutions across various industries.

Where to Find Skilled CodeIgniter Developers

You can hire a CodeIgniter developer from various online platforms that connect employers with software professionals. These include Braintrust and LinkedIn. You can also post job listings on websites like Indeed, Glassdoor, or Stack Overflow Jobs. Additionally, you might find candidates through local job fairs, university recruitment, or networking events. Remember to consider the project needs when choosing where to hire, as some platforms may be more geared towards freelancers while others.

But hiring top CodeIgniter developers is challenging, as thousands of companies compete to recruit from the limited pool of experienced CodeIgniter developers. The shortage of highly skilled developers also means hiring quality CodeIgniter developers is a costly and time-consuming affair.

How to Evaluate a CodeIgniter Developer

Evaluating a CodeIgniter developer is crucial to ensure the success of your project. When you hire a CodeIgniter developer, it’s essential to look for strong technical skills in PHP and CodeIgniter, experience with MVC frameworks, and a good understanding of web technologies and databases. Additionally, assessing their problem-solving skills and knowledge of web security best practices is vital.

Essential Skills to Look For

A good CodeIgniter developer should have experience with version control systems and demonstrate good communication skills. They should also show a propensity for continuous learning, which is crucial for staying updated with the latest technologies and best practices.

Interview Questions to Ask

When interviewing candidates, focus on their technical skills, portfolios, cultural fit, and communication skills. Ask about their experience with MVC frameworks and OOP concepts, and how they handle problem-solving and web security. Utilize recruitment agencies for vetting and hiring assistance if needed.

Assessing Portfolio and Experience

Reviewing a candidate’s portfolio is an excellent way to gauge their expertise and experience. Look for evidence of quality execution and strategic development in their past projects. Engaging in tech communities and designing hackathons can also provide insights into their skills and collaboration abilities.

Effective communication is key to successful collaboration. Ensure that the developer is responsive to feedback and can work well within a team environment.

Cost of Hiring a CodeIgniter Developer

The cost to Hire Codeigniter Developer varies widely based on several factors. These include the developer’s experience level, geographical location, and the complexity of your project. For instance, a mid-level developer in the U.S. might command a salary of around $75,000 to $100,000 per year. However, this could be significantly higher in areas with a high cost of living or for highly experienced, high-quality developers. Freelance or contract rates can vary even more, ranging from $20 to $100 or more per hour.

Factors Influencing Rates

When you Hire Codeigniter Developer, several factors can influence the rates. The developer’s experience and expertise play a crucial role. A North American or Western European developer might charge anywhere from $50 to $150 per hour or more, while a developer from Eastern Europe, Asia, or Africa might charge between $15 and $50 per hour. The complexity of your project and the level of experience needed can also significantly influence hourly rates.

Average Hourly Rates

The hourly rate of a CodeIgniter developer depends on their experience, expertise, and geographical location. For example, a North American or Western European developer might charge anywhere from $50 to $150 per hour or more. In contrast, a developer from Eastern Europe, Asia, or Africa might charge between $15 and $50 per hour. These are just rough estimates, and the actual rates can vary based on market demand and other factors.

Budgeting for Your Project

When planning to Hire Codeigniter Developer, it’s essential to consider all the factors that can influence the cost. This includes the developer’s experience, geographical location, and the complexity of your project. Proper budgeting ensures that you can afford the right talent for your needs without compromising on quality.

Hiring Models for CodeIgniter Developers

CodeIgniter developer coding on a laptop

When you decide to hire a CodeIgniter developer, understanding the different hiring models available is crucial. Each model has its own set of advantages and challenges, and the best choice depends on your specific project requirements and budget constraints. Whether you opt for freelancers, full-time employees, offshore development teams, or part-time and contract options, it’s essential to weigh the pros and cons carefully.

Freelancers vs. Full-Time Employees

Freelancers offer flexibility and can be a cost-effective solution for short-term projects. They are often available on various online platforms that connect employers with software professionals. On the other hand, full-time employees provide long-term stability and are more likely to be invested in your company’s success. However, they come with higher costs and additional responsibilities such as benefits and taxes.

Offshore Development Teams

Offshore development teams can be an excellent option if you’re looking to reduce costs without compromising on quality. These teams are usually based in countries with lower labor costs, making them an attractive choice for many businesses. However, it’s important to consider potential challenges such as cultural and time zone differences, which can impact communication and project timelines.

Part-Time and Contract Options

Part-time and contract options offer a middle ground between freelancers and full-time employees. These models provide the flexibility to scale your team up or down based on project needs. They are particularly useful for businesses that require specialized skills for a limited period. However, managing part-time or contract workers can be challenging, especially when it comes to ensuring consistent quality and meeting deadlines.

Choosing the right hiring model is a critical step in the recruitment process. It can significantly impact your project’s success and overall cost-effectiveness. Therefore, take the time to evaluate your options and select the model that best aligns with your business goals and project requirements.

Onboarding Your CodeIgniter Developer

Team onboarding a new CodeIgniter developer

Setting Up Development Environment

When you hire a CodeIgniter developer, the first step is to ensure that the development environment is properly set up. This includes configuring the necessary software, tools, and libraries that the developer will need to work efficiently. A well-prepared environment can significantly enhance productivity and reduce initial setup time.

Defining Project Scope and Goals

Clearly defining the project scope and goals is crucial for a successful onboarding process. This involves outlining the specific tasks, milestones, and deliverables expected from the developer. By setting clear expectations, you can ensure that the developer understands the project’s objectives and works towards achieving them.

Effective onboarding is not just about setting up the environment but also about ensuring that the developer is aligned with the project’s vision and goals.

Effective Communication Strategies

Effective communication is key to a successful onboarding process. Establishing regular check-ins, using collaborative tools, and maintaining open lines of communication can help in addressing any issues promptly. This ensures that the developer feels supported and can contribute effectively to the project.

Best Practices for Managing CodeIgniter Developers

Managing CodeIgniter developers effectively is crucial for the success of your projects. Implementing agile methodologies can significantly enhance productivity and ensure timely delivery of tasks. Regular code reviews are essential to maintain high-quality standards and to identify potential issues early in the development process. Performance monitoring and feedback play a vital role in keeping the development team aligned with project goals and in fostering continuous improvement.

Common Challenges in Hiring CodeIgniter Developers

Hiring top CodeIgniter developers is challenging, as thousands of companies compete to recruit from the limited pool of experienced CodeIgniter developers. The shortage of highly skilled developers also means hiring quality CodeIgniter developers is a costly and time-consuming affair.

Technical Skill Gaps

Finding developers with strong technical skills in PHP and CodeIgniter, experience with MVC frameworks and OOP concepts, and a good understanding of web technologies and databases can be difficult. Additionally, checking their problem-solving skills and their knowledge of web security best practices is crucial.

Cultural and Time Zone Differences

When you hire developers from India or other countries, you may face challenges related to cultural and time zone differences. These can impact communication and project timelines, making it essential to address these challenges proactively.

Retention Strategies

Retaining skilled CodeIgniter developers can be tough due to the high demand for their expertise. Offering competitive salaries and creating a positive work environment are key strategies to keep your developers motivated and committed.

Future Trends in CodeIgniter Development

Developer coding future trends in CodeIgniter

As we move forward, the landscape of CodeIgniter development is set to evolve significantly. Developers are increasingly exploring the latest technologies in software development for 2024. This includes the integration of AI/ML, blockchain, and cloud/DevOps into CodeIgniter projects, which is expected to enhance functionality and performance.

Emerging Technologies

The adoption of emerging technologies is becoming more prevalent in CodeIgniter development. AI/ML, blockchain, and cloud/DevOps are at the forefront, offering new possibilities for creating more efficient and secure applications. These technologies are not just trends but are becoming essential components of modern web development.

Evolving Best Practices

With the rapid advancement in technology, best practices in CodeIgniter development are also evolving. Agile methodologies, continuous integration, and deployment, as well as automated testing, are becoming standard practices. These methodologies ensure that projects are delivered on time and meet the highest quality standards.

Market Demand and Opportunities

The demand for skilled CodeIgniter developers is on the rise. Businesses are looking to transform legacy systems with cloud solutions, data analytics, and UX/UI design. This growing demand presents numerous opportunities for developers to work on innovative projects and advance their careers.

Staying updated with the latest trends and technologies is crucial for any developer looking to excel in the field. The ability to adapt and integrate new tools and practices will set successful developers apart from the rest.

Case Studies of Successful CodeIgniter Projects

E-commerce Solutions

CodeIgniter has proven to be an excellent choice for developing robust e-commerce solutions. Its flexibility and ease of use allow developers to create custom features tailored to specific business needs. Many businesses have leveraged CodeIgniter to build scalable and secure online stores, enhancing their digital presence and driving sales.

Enterprise Applications

Enterprise applications require a framework that can handle complex processes and large volumes of data. CodeIgniter’s lightweight nature and powerful features make it an ideal choice for such projects. Companies have successfully implemented CodeIgniter to streamline operations, improve efficiency, and support business growth.

Custom Web Portals

Custom web portals built with CodeIgniter offer unique functionalities that cater to specific user needs. These portals benefit from CodeIgniter’s MVC architecture, which ensures clean and maintainable code. Organizations have used CodeIgniter to develop portals that enhance user engagement and provide seamless experiences.

Hiring a CodeIgniter developer can significantly enhance your web development projects by leveraging the robust and versatile capabilities of the CodeIgniter framework. Whether you need scalable and secure web applications or tailored solutions to meet your unique business needs, dedicated CodeIgniter developers can deliver high-quality results. By understanding your specific requirements and utilizing the latest APIs and best practices, these professionals ensure that your web solutions are both innovative and reliable. With various platforms available for hiring, such as Braintrust, LinkedIn, and job listing websites, finding the right developer to align with your project goals has never been easier. Invest in a skilled CodeIgniter developer to drive your business forward and achieve your digital objectives.

Frequently Asked Questions

Where can I hire a CodeIgniter Developer?

You can hire a CodeIgniter developer from various online platforms such as Braintrust, LinkedIn, Indeed, Glassdoor, and Stack Overflow Jobs. Additionally, local job fairs, university recruitment, and networking events are good options.

How do I recruit a dedicated CodeIgniter Developer?

To recruit a dedicated CodeIgniter developer, clearly define your project requirements, post detailed job listings on relevant platforms, and conduct thorough interviews to assess candidates’ skills and experience. Consider using specialized recruitment agencies if needed.

How much does a CodeIgniter Developer charge per hour?

The hourly rate for a CodeIgniter developer can vary widely based on their experience, location, and the complexity of the project. On average, rates can range from $15 to $100 per hour.

What are the benefits of using CodeIgniter for web development?

CodeIgniter offers several benefits including a small footprint, exceptional performance, clear documentation, and a straightforward learning curve. It also supports MVC architecture, which helps in organizing code efficiently.

What essential skills should a CodeIgniter developer have?

A skilled CodeIgniter developer should have a strong grasp of PHP, experience with MVC frameworks, proficiency in front-end technologies (HTML, CSS, JavaScript), and knowledge of database management (MySQL). They should also be familiar with version control systems like Git.

What are the key features of the CodeIgniter framework?

Key features of CodeIgniter include a lightweight framework, built-in libraries for common tasks, easy error handling, security features, and excellent documentation. It also supports database abstraction and form validation.

How can I ensure the quality of a CodeIgniter developer’s work?

To ensure quality, conduct regular code reviews, set up a robust testing environment, and use performance monitoring tools. Additionally, adopt agile methodologies and maintain clear communication to track progress and address issues promptly.

What are some success stories with CodeIgniter?

Many companies have successfully used CodeIgniter for their projects. Examples include e-commerce platforms, enterprise applications, and custom web portals. These projects benefit from CodeIgniter’s scalability, security, and performance.